EXTRACTOR FANS

FAQ

Extractor fans are devices that remove unwanted odors, moisture, and smoke from the air. They help improve indoor air quality by ventilating spaces like kitchens and bathrooms. When choosing one, consider the room size, noise level, and energy efficiency to find a suitable option for your home.

Extractor fans work by using a motor to draw air through a vent or duct. They expel stale air outside, reducing humidity and preventing mold growth. Look for models with adjustable speeds and easy installation features to ensure effective performance in your space.

The size of extractor fan you need depends on the room's volume. Measure the length, width, and height of the room to calculate its cubic meters. Choose a fan with an airflow rate that matches or exceeds this volume per hour for optimal ventilation.

Extractor fans can be energy efficient if they have a high energy rating and modern features like timers or humidity sensors. These features help reduce electricity consumption by running only when necessary. Check the energy label and user reviews to gauge efficiency before purchasing.

Extractor fans should be installed in areas with high moisture or odor levels, such as kitchens above cooktops or in bathrooms near showers. Proper placement ensures maximum efficiency in removing unwanted air particles. Always follow installation guidelines or consult a professional for best results.

Extractor fans require regular maintenance to function effectively. Clean the filters and vents regularly to prevent blockages and ensure smooth operation. Periodic checks of the motor and wiring can also extend the fan's lifespan.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for specific maintenance tasks.
